Article details
Open a Redactorr package
Help a recipient open a protected package with the correct link, passphrase, and browser flow.
Outcome
A recipient can open the package or identify the exact safe issue to send back to the sender.
Before You Start
- Have the package link or file from the sender.
- Have the passphrase or access details through the approved channel.
- Use a supported browser and avoid forwarding access details unnecessarily.
1. Open the package path
Open the package link or receive screen from the sender. If it does not load, ask the sender to confirm the link before sharing screenshots.
Check before you continue: The package screen opens and asks for the expected access step.
2. Enter the passphrase carefully
Paste or type the passphrase exactly as provided. Watch for extra spaces, old passphrases, or a passphrase sent for a different package.
Check before you continue: The package opens or returns a clear access error.
3. Send a safe issue summary
If it still fails, tell the sender the step, browser, and error category. Do not send the passphrase or package contents in the support message.
Check before you continue: The sender has enough safe context to resend or troubleshoot.
Completion Check
- The link and passphrase belong to the same package.
- The package opens or the sender receives a safe error summary.
- Package contents and passphrases are not pasted into support by default.
Safe Examples
- Package did not open after passphrase entry.
- Open Package page loaded, but the package showed an access error.
If You Need Support
Contact support when:
- The package screen fails before passphrase entry.
- The sender confirms details but the package still cannot be opened.
